Home
last modified time | relevance | path

Searched refs:NumDstElt (Results 1 – 2 of 2)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Analysis/
H A DConstantFolding.cpp158 unsigned NumDstElt = cast<FixedVectorType>(DestVTy)->getNumElements(); in FoldBitCast() local
160 if (NumDstElt == NumSrcElt) in FoldBitCast()
180 IntegerType::get(C->getContext(), FPWidth), NumDstElt); in FoldBitCast()
209 if (NumDstElt < NumSrcElt) { in FoldBitCast()
212 unsigned Ratio = NumSrcElt/NumDstElt; in FoldBitCast()
215 for (unsigned i = 0; i != NumDstElt; ++i) { in FoldBitCast()
252 unsigned Ratio = NumDstElt/NumSrcElt; in FoldBitCast()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/GlobalISel/
H A DLegalizerHelper.cpp3141 int NumDstElt = DstTy.getNumElements(); in lowerBitcast() local
3150 if (NumSrcElt < NumDstElt) { // Source element type is larger. in lowerBitcast()
3159 DstCastTy = LLT::fixed_vector(NumDstElt / NumSrcElt, DstEltTy); in lowerBitcast()
3161 } else if (NumSrcElt > NumDstElt) { // Source element type is smaller. in lowerBitcast()
3171 SrcPartTy = LLT::fixed_vector(NumSrcElt / NumDstElt, SrcEltTy); in lowerBitcast()